Question 1: How does a star force calculator determine success probabilities?

Calculators often rely on publicly available data, datamining efforts, or crowd-sourced information regarding observed success rates within the game. These data points are then used to construct probabilistic models that estimate the likelihood of successful enhancement at various levels.

Question 2: Are the cost estimations provided by these calculators absolute?

Cost estimations are based on average values and probabilities. Actual costs may vary due to the inherent randomness of the enhancement system. Market fluctuations for required resources can also influence final costs.

Question 3: Can a calculator guarantee successful enhancements?

No tool can guarantee success. Enhancement systems inherently involve chance. The calculator provides probabilities, not certainties. Its purpose is to inform decision-making, not to circumvent the game’s mechanics.

Question 4: How do I choose the right star force calculator?

Consider factors such as data accuracy, resource comprehensiveness, and user interface clarity. Community reviews and recommendations can be valuable resources in selecting a reputable and reliable calculator.

Question 5: What are the limitations of using these calculators?

Calculators rely on available data and assumptions. Game updates or changes to underlying mechanics can impact the accuracy of predictions. Prudent resource management remains essential, even when utilizing a calculator.

Tips for Effective Enhancement

Optimizing equipment enhancement requires a strategic approach. These tips provide practical guidance for navigating the complexities of upgrade systems and maximizing the utility of enhancement calculators.

Tip 1: Prioritize Early Enhancements

Initial enhancement levels often offer higher success rates and lower costs. Prioritizing these early upgrades provides a cost-effective foundation for subsequent, more challenging enhancements.

Tip 2: Understand Breakpoints

Certain enhancement levels represent significant jumps in item power or unlock new functionalities. Identifying these breakpoints allows for targeted upgrades and efficient resource allocation.

Tip 3: Utilize Safeguard Mechanisms

Many games offer safeguard mechanisms, such as protective scrolls or enhancement insurance, to mitigate potential losses from failed upgrades. Employing these safeguards strategically minimizes risk, especially at higher enhancement levels.

Tip 4: Diversify Enhancement Attempts

Instead of concentrating resources on a single item, consider diversifying enhancement attempts across multiple pieces of equipment. This balanced approach distributes risk and increases the likelihood of overall progression.

Tip 5: Adapt to Market Conditions

In games with dynamic economies, the cost of enhancement materials can fluctuate. Monitor market prices and adjust enhancement strategies accordingly to optimize resource expenditure.
